Synchronicity, a tweak that lets you use your device while it syncs with iTunes, has been updated with a simpler, cleaner design and support for 3.x firmwares.

Synchronicity gives you the option to use your device during an iTunes sync. Instead of being stuck at the lock screen while you transfer new content, you can unlock, run apps, make calls, etc. You can do whatever you want, except run the Music app, which is disabled during syncs to prevent data corruption.

Synchronicity works on any device with firmware 3.x - 4.x.



What's New in This Version:
● Simpler, cleaner design: icon in statusbar
● bug fixes
● 3.x compatibility

You can purchase Synchronicity for $2.00 from the Cydia Store.
